South Boys Hoopsters Win At Prior Lake

Cougars remain unbeaten in South Suburban Conference play with 68-45 victory on Friday night.

The Lakeville South boys basketball team won its seventh game in a row and remained unbeaten in 2011 with a 68-45 victory at Prior Lake in a South Suburban Conference matchup on Friday night.

With forward Alex Richter leading the way en route to a game-high 21 points, the Cougars took a commanding 37-21 halftime lead, then continued to build on that edge in the final 18 minutes to win by nearly two dozen.

Forward Jon Christensen and guard Riley West recorded 15 and 10 points, respectively, as eight South players managed at least two points in the triumph.

The win kept the Cougars unblemished in all four of their South Suburban contests, a stretch that also includes wins over Rosemount, Apple Valley and Lakeville North.

South is now 8-2 overall this season and has not lost since a narrow 93-89 loss to Class AAAA's No. 1-ranked Hopkins on Dec. 14. The Cougars other setback came in the season opener, 61-60, against St. Paul Johnson — the No. 2 ranked team in Class AAA — on Dec. 3.

Next up for the Cougars is a back-to-back set against the Bloomington contingent of the South Suburban as South travels to Jefferson on Tuesday night before hosting Kennedy Friday night.

Results were not currently available for Friday night's girls basketball game that also pitted Lakeville South against Prior Lake.
